ensp查看mstp和vrrp配置命令
时间: 2025-01-03 18:13:35 浏览: 815
### 查看MSTP配置
在eNSP环境中,可以通过以下命令来查看MSTP的相关配置:
```shell
display stp brief
```
这条命令可以显示当前交换机上所有实例的状态摘要信息[^2]。
对于更详细的MSTP区域配置信息,则应使用如下指令:
```shell
display stp region-configuration
```
这会展示关于MST域的具体参数设定情况,比如修订级别和地区名称等重要细节[^3]。
针对特定实例的信息查询,有专门的命令可供调用:
```shell
display stp instance 10
```
上述例子中`instance 10`可以根据实际需求替换为其他编号,以此获取指定实例下的端口角色、路径成本以及转发者状态等内容[^4]。
### 查看VRRP配置
要检查VRRP的运行状况和已有的设置,应当执行下面这个命令:
```shell
display vrrp
```
此命令能够提供有关各个接口上的VRRP组详情,包括但不限于优先级数值、主备状态切换时间间隔等方面的数据[^1]。
另外,若需深入了解某个具体VRRP组的情况,还可以进一步限定范围:
```shell
display vrrp interface GigabitEthernet 0/0/1
```
这里指定了GigabitEthernet 0/0/1作为目标接口,从而集中呈现该接口下各VRRP组的工作情形。
相关问题
ensp配置mstp和vrrp
<think>首先,用户的问题是关于在ENSP中配置MSTP和VRRP的详细步骤及参数说明。系统级指令要求我必须使用中文回答,并遵循特定的LaTeX格式:行内数学表达式用$...$,独立公式用$$...$$。另外,我需要生成相关问题。回顾引用内容:-引用[1]讨论了在eNSP中配置MSTP+VRRP实现负载均衡和网关备份。它提到了MSTP的优势(基于VLAN构建无环路径树),VRRP的配置参数优化,如抢占延迟时间和上行链路追踪。-引用[2]简要介绍了VRRP和MSTP的概念:VRRP用于路由器高可用性,MSTP是MultipleSpanningTreeProtocol。用户的问题聚焦于配置步骤和参数说明,所以我需要提供详细的、结构清晰的指南。回答结构:1.**引言**:简要介绍MSTP和VRRP及其在ENSP中的作用。2.**配置步骤**:分步说明如何配置MSTP和VRRP。-包括拓扑设计、设备配置等。3.**参数说明**:解释关键参数,如VRRP的优先级、抢占模式、MSTP的实例和VLAN映射。4.**示例配置**:提供代码或命令行示例,类似快速排序的示例。5.**注意事项**:强调最佳实践,如确保VRRPMaster与MSTP根桥一致。6.**生成相关问题**:在末尾添加相关问题,用§§相关问题§§分隔。确保回答真实可靠:基于引用和一般网络知识。引用中提到eNSP是华为的工具,所以配置应使用华为命令。LaTeX使用:-行内数学表达式:如变量或简单公式,例如$VLAN_ID$。-独立公式:如果有复杂公式,但在这个上下文中可能不需要,除非有数学推导。生成相关问题:在回答后,添加3-5个相关问题。完整回答框架:-开头:直接回答问题。-主体:-MSTP配置步骤。-VRRP配置步骤。-参数解释。-结尾:注意事项。-相关问题。具体内容:-**MSTP配置**:-在交换机上启用MSTP。-配置MST域:名称、修订级别。-定义实例和VLAN映射。-设置根桥优先级。-**VRRP配置**:-在路由器或三层交换机上配置。-创建VRRP组,设置虚拟IP。-配置优先级、抢占延迟。-上行链路追踪。参数说明:-MSTP参数:如$instance-id$、$vlan-list$。-VRRP参数:如$priority$、$preempt-mode$、$track$。示例配置:使用命令行代码块,就像示例中的Python代码。引用标识:在相关段落末尾添加[^1],但引用是固定的,我需要自然地引用。系统指令说:"回答中引用的段落末尾自然地添加引用标识",但引用是用户提供的,所以我应该在基于引用时添加[^1]或[^2]。用户说:"上述引用仅供参考",但我应该参考它们。最终,回答用中文。</think>### ENSP中配置MSTP和VRRP的详细步骤及参数说明
在华为eNSP中,配置MSTP(Multiple Spanning Tree Protocol)和VRRP(Virtual Router Redundancy Protocol)主要用于实现网络冗余、负载均衡和网关备份。MSTP基于VLAN构建无环路径树,避免环路;VRRP则创建虚拟路由器组,确保网关高可用性。以下是基于实验和最佳实践的详细步骤及参数说明,确保配置可靠高效[^1][^2]。
#### 1. **拓扑设计准备**
- 创建一个典型拓扑:包括两台汇聚层交换机(如S1和S2)、接入层交换机(如S3),以及终端设备。
- 确保所有设备通过Trunk链路连接,VLAN配置已完成(例如,VLAN 10和VLAN 20用于负载均衡)。
- 关键点:VRRP的Master设备应与MSTP的根桥对应,以避免次优路径[^1]。
#### 2. **MSTP配置步骤**
MSTP允许基于VLAN划分实例,实现负载分担。配置在交换机上进行(以S1和S2为例)。
**步骤:**
1. **启用MSTP并定义域**:
在全局配置模式下,设置MST域名称和修订级别(确保所有交换机相同)。
```bash
system-view
stp enable # 启用STP协议
stp mode mstp # 设置模式为MSTP
stp region-configuration # 进入MST域配置视图
region-name MSTP_DOMAIN # 域名称,自定义
revision-level 1 # 修订级别,默认0,需一致
```
2. **映射VLAN到实例**:
创建实例(如Instance 1和Instance 2),并将VLAN分配到不同实例。
```bash
instance 1 vlan 10 # 实例1处理VLAN 10
instance 2 vlan 20 # 实例2处理VLAN 20
active region-configuration # 激活配置
```
3. **设置根桥优先级**:
为每个实例指定根桥和备份桥(优先级值越小,越可能成为根桥)。
```bash
stp instance 1 root primary # S1作为实例1的主根桥,优先级自动设为0
stp instance 2 root secondary # S1作为实例2的备份根桥,优先级默认32768
# 在S2上配置相反:stp instance 2 root primary,stp instance 1 root secondary
```
4. **验证配置**:
使用命令检查状态。
```bash
display stp instance 1 # 查看实例1状态
display stp brief # 简要状态
```
**关键参数说明:**
- `region-name`:MST域名称,需全网一致,否则实例不生效。
- `revision-level`:修订级别,值范围$0 \sim 65535$,用于标识配置版本。
- `instance-id vlan-list`:实例ID($1 \sim 4094$)与VLAN列表映射,实现负载分担。
- `stp instance root primary/secondary`:优先级自动调整(primary: $0$, secondary: $4096$),手动优先级命令为`stp priority priority-value`(范围$0 \sim 61440$,步长4096)。
#### 3. **VRRP配置步骤**
VRRP在汇聚层路由器或三层交换机上配置,创建虚拟IP作为网关。
**步骤:**
1. **配置接口IP和VRRP组**:
在VLAN接口下启用VRRP,设置虚拟IP。
```bash
interface Vlanif 10 # 进入VLAN 10接口
ip address 192.168.10.1 255.255.255.0 # 真实IP
vrrp vrid 1 virtual-ip 192.168.10.254 # 创建VRID 1,虚拟IP
vrrp vrid 1 priority 120 # 设置优先级,默认100,值越高越优先成为Master
vrrp vrid 1 preempt-mode timer delay 20 # 启用抢占模式,延迟20秒
```
2. **配置上行链路追踪**:
添加Track项,监控上行链路状态(如接口故障时自动降低优先级)。
```bash
track 1 interface GigabitEthernet0/0/1 # 创建Track 1,监控上行口
vrrp vrid 1 track 1 reduced 30 # 上行故障时优先级减30
```
3. **设置多个VRRP组实现负载均衡**:
在另一个VLAN接口重复配置。
```bash
interface Vlanif 20
vrrp vrid 2 virtual-ip 192.168.20.254
vrrp vrid 2 priority 100 # S2作为此组的Master
```
4. **验证配置**:
检查VRRP状态。
```bash
display vrrp # 查看所有VRRP组状态
```
**关键参数说明:**
- `vrid`:VRRP组ID($1 \sim 255$),同一组内设备需一致。
- `virtual-ip`:虚拟IP地址,作为网关。
- `priority`:优先级范围$1 \sim 254$,默认$100$;$255$保留给IP所有者。
- `preempt-mode timer delay`:抢占延迟时间(秒),避免频繁切换,范围$0 \sim 255$。
- `track reduced`:上行链路追踪,优先级减少值范围$1 \sim 255$,确保故障时备机接管。
#### 4. **配置注意事项**
- **一致性检查**:确保所有交换机的MST域参数(名称、修订级别)匹配,否则实例不生效。
- **负载均衡优化**:VRRP组1的Master对应MSTP实例1的根桥(如S1处理VLAN 10),组2对应实例2(S2处理VLAN 20),实现流量分担[^1]。
- **抢占延迟设置**:建议延迟$10 \sim 30$秒,防止网络抖动导致误切换。
- **上行链路追踪**:监控关键接口(如连接核心层的端口),提高可靠性。
- **测试与验证**:在eNSP中模拟链路故障,使用`ping`和`display`命令验证切换时间(通常<1秒)。
#### 5. **完整示例拓扑**
```bash
# S1配置片段:
stp region-configuration
region-name MSTP_DOMAIN
revision-level 1
instance 1 vlan 10
instance 2 vlan 20
active region-configuration
interface Vlanif 10
vrrp vrid 1 virtual-ip 192.168.10.254
vrrp vrid 1 priority 120
vrrp vrid 1 preempt-mode timer delay 20
vrrp vrid 1 track 1 reduced 30
track 1 interface GigabitEthernet0/0/1
# S2配置(对称):
stp region-configuration
... # 相同域参数
instance 1 vlan 10
instance 2 vlan 20
active region-configuration
interface Vlanif 20
vrrp vrid 2 virtual-ip 192.168.20.254
vrrp vrid 2 priority 120
```
通过此配置,网络可实现无环路、网关冗余和负载均衡。eNSP实践有助于加深理解理论,如避免单点故障[^1][^2]。
ensp mstp和vrrp配置实例
ensp mstp是指Ethernet Network Service Provider Multiple Spanning Tree Protocol,它是一种用于在以太网网络中实现多重树协议的技术。MSTP使用多个生成树来分解网络拓扑,以提高网络的可靠性和性能。
vrrp是指Virtual Router Redundancy Protocol,它是一种用于在网络中实现虚拟路由器冗余的协议。VRRP允许将多个物理路由器组成一个虚拟路由器,以实现路由器的高可用性和无故障切换。
下面是ensp mstp和vrrp的配置实例:
1.ensp mstp配置实例:
- 配置MSTP实例参数:
mstp instance <instance-id> vlan <vlan-id>
- 配置MSTP根桥:
stp root primary|secondary
- 配置MSTP边桥:
stp bridge <bridge-id> priority <priority>
- 配置MSTP端口:
interface <interface-id>
stp edged-port enable|disable
2.vrrp配置实例:
- 配置VRRP组:
interface <interface-id>
vrrp vrid <vrid> virtual-ip <virtual-ip>
- 配置VRRP优先级:
vrrp vrid <vrid> priority <priority>
- 配置VRRP追随者优先级:
vrrp vrid <vrid> follower-priority <follower-priority>
- 配置VRRP追随者路由器ID:
vrrp vrid <vrid> follower-id <follower-id>
阅读全文
相关推荐














